Template-Type: ReDIF-Article 1.0 Author-Name: Hao-Chang Yang Author-Email: 15064302717@163.com Author-Workplace-Name: School of Economics and Finance, Xi’an Jiaotong University, China Title: Impact of Environmental Stringency on Energy Efficiency Abstract: This paper investigates the impact of environment policy stringency on energy efficiency by using the unbalanced data of 23 countries from 1990 to 2015. The regression results show that increased stringency of environmental policy implementation has a negative impact on energy intensity, as well as a lagging effect. This finding illustrates that strict environmental protection policies can effectively reduce unit resource energy consumption, reduce resource waste, and promote energy efficiency.
